Why Tankless Gas Water Heaters Need Regular Attention

Unlike a conventional tank that stores and reheats a fixed volume of water, a tankless gas heater fires up on demand and pushes water across a heat exchanger at high temperatures. That process is remarkably efficient, but it also exposes the internal components to repeated thermal cycling and, over time, mineral accumulation. Tualatin’s water carries dissolved calcium and magnesium that gradually coat the heat exchanger as scale. Even a thin layer of scale forces the burner to work harder, lengthens heating times, and erodes the fuel savings that made the unit appealing in the first place.

Beyond scale, a gas-fired unit relies on proper combustion, clean venting, and unobstructed airflow. Soot buildup on the burner, a clogged air intake, or a partially blocked condensate line can all throw off performance and trigger safety lockouts. Routine maintenance catches these issues while they are minor adjustments rather than full repairs. When you keep a tankless system tuned, you protect both its efficiency rating and its expected service life.

What Our Maintenance Visit Includes

When we service a tankless gas water heater, we work through a methodical sequence designed to address every component that affects performance, safety, and longevity. Each step builds on the last, so nothing gets overlooked. Our technicians document findings as they go, which gives you a clear picture of your unit’s condition and any items worth watching.

  • Descaling the heat exchanger: We circulate a food-safe descaling solution through the unit to dissolve mineral buildup, restoring efficient heat transfer and consistent water temperatures.
  • Inspecting and cleaning the burner assembly: A clean burner ensures complete combustion, which means safer operation and better fuel economy.
  • Checking the venting and combustion air supply: We confirm that intake and exhaust paths are clear and properly sealed to prevent backdrafting.
  • Cleaning the inlet water filter screen: This small screen traps sediment, and a clogged screen restricts flow and reduces output.
  • Testing gas pressure and ignition: Proper pressure and reliable ignition keep the unit firing smoothly without short cycling.
  • Verifying error codes and sensor function: We read the unit’s diagnostics to identify any flags the system has logged since the last service.

After the hands-on work, we run the unit through several heating cycles to confirm it reaches and holds the target temperature without hesitation. This live testing is where many subtle problems reveal themselves—a flow sensor lagging slightly, a temperature swing under heavy draw, or a vent that whistles under full combustion load. Identifying these patterns during a planned visit means you avoid being caught off guard later.

Signs Your Tankless Unit Is Asking for Service

Many homeowners assume a tankless heater is maintenance-free because there’s no tank to drain. In practice, the unit communicates its needs in several recognizable ways, and learning to read those signals helps you schedule service before a small inconvenience becomes a cold shower. Pay attention to how the system behaves day to day, especially during the colder months when incoming groundwater temperatures drop and the burner works harder to hit your set point.

Fluctuating water temperature is one of the clearest warning signs, often pointing to scale on the heat exchanger or a flow sensor that needs cleaning. A noticeable drop in flow rate frequently traces back to a clogged inlet screen or mineral restriction. Unusual noises—rumbling, ticking, or popping—can indicate combustion issues or trapped sediment. And if your unit displays error codes more often than it used to, that is the system telling you a component is operating outside its normal range. Technical Details That Make a Difference

Tankless gas water heaters operate within tight tolerances, and understanding a few specifications helps explain why professional maintenance matters. Most residential models are rated for a specific flow rate measured in gallons per minute at a given temperature rise. As scale accumulates, that effective temperature rise shrinks, which is why a unit that once supplied two showers simultaneously may begin struggling. Restoring the heat exchanger to clean condition brings the rated capacity back.

Condensing models, which capture additional heat from exhaust gases for higher efficiency, produce acidic condensate that must drain freely through a neutralizer. We check that this drainage path stays clear and that the neutralizing media has not been exhausted. Gas supply pressure also plays a critical role—too low and the burner cannot modulate correctly, too high and combustion becomes inefficient. Our technicians measure and adjust these parameters as part of every visit, ensuring the unit performs to manufacturer specifications.
